Dragerwerk has filed a patent for a sensor arrangement and process to analyze gases for specific components. The arrangement includes an electrochemical sensor with a temperature sensor unit that measures the temperature of the sensor’s components to determine and potentially control their temperatures. Gas analysis sensor arrangement with temperature control

A sensor arrangement for analyzing gas for predetermined gas components has been filed for a patent. The arrangement includes an electrochemical sensor with measuring and counter electrodes, electrical contacts, and an electrolyte. Additionally, a temperature sensor unit with a temperature sensor and an electrically conductive measuring element is included. The measuring element has a contact segment in thermal contact with a measurement object of the electrochemical sensor. The temperature sensor measures a variable correlating with the contact segment temperature, allowing for the determination of the temperature of the measuring electrode and/or counter electrode based on the measured variable.

Furthermore, the sensor arrangement may include a controllable heater and a signal processing control unit to maintain the temperature within a predetermined range. The heater can be a radiation source emitting electromagnetic radiation towards the electrodes, with the control unit adjusting the intensity based on signals from the temperature sensor unit. Additionally, a cooling system can be included to cool the electrodes, with the control unit controlling the system based on temperature sensor signals. The process for analyzing gas involves using the sensor arrangement to measure detection variables correlated with gas presence or concentration, along with temperature measurements to determine electrode temperatures and control heating or cooling systems to maintain desired temperature ranges.
